编程,作为现代社会的一项基本技能,正变得越来越重要。无论是为了职业发展,还是个人兴趣,掌握一门编程语言都是一项有益的投资。对于编程新手来说,入门往往是最困难的阶段。下面,我将为你提供一系列的入门技巧和全面教程,帮助你轻松掌握编程语言。
第一部分:选择合适的编程语言
1.1 了解自己的需求
在开始学习编程之前,首先要明确自己的学习目的。是为了开发网页、移动应用,还是进行数据分析?不同的编程语言适用于不同的领域。
1.2 研究热门语言
目前市场上流行的编程语言有Python、Java、JavaScript、C++等。Python因其简单易学、应用广泛而被推荐给编程新手。
第二部分:基础入门教程
2.1 学习环境搭建
每个编程语言都需要相应的开发环境。以Python为例,你需要安装Python解释器和相应的集成开发环境(IDE),如PyCharm或Visual Studio Code。
2.2 基础语法学习
学习一门编程语言,首先要掌握其基础语法。例如,Python的基本语法包括变量定义、数据类型、运算符等。
2.3 编写第一个程序
编写第一个程序是学习编程的重要一步。以Python为例,你可以尝试编写一个简单的“Hello, World!”程序。
print("Hello, World!")
2.4 练习编程
通过编写小程序和解决实际问题来提高编程能力。例如,编写一个计算器程序,实现基本的加减乘除运算。
第三部分:进阶学习技巧
3.1 阅读源码
通过阅读其他程序员的源码,可以学习到更多的编程技巧和设计模式。
3.2 参与开源项目
加入开源项目,与其他开发者合作,可以提升自己的编程能力和团队协作能力。
3.3 学习版本控制
掌握版本控制工具(如Git)可以帮助你更好地管理代码,提高开发效率。
第四部分:常见编程问题及解决方案
4.1 编程错误处理
在编程过程中,错误是不可避免的。学会如何查找和解决错误,对于成为一名优秀的程序员至关重要。
4.2 性能优化
在编写程序时,要注重性能优化,提高程序的运行效率。
4.3 安全编程
了解常见的网络安全问题,编写安全的代码,保护用户数据。
总结
学习编程语言是一个循序渐进的过程,需要耐心和坚持。通过以上教程,相信你已经对编程语言入门有了基本的了解。记住,多练习、多思考,你将逐渐成为一名优秀的程序员。祝你在编程的道路上越走越远!
